Following the snap presidential election held the previous day, candidate Lee Jae-myung has been elected president, and the overseas virtual asset (cryptocurrency) industry is expressing anticipation for President Lee’s virtual asset policies.

On the 4th (KST), the virtual asset-focused media outlet Block B reported that President Lee’s pledges include a spot exchange-traded fund (ETF) and a Korean won-linked stablecoin, evaluating that Korea’s virtual asset market may benefit.

In addition, the second phase of legislation following last July’s enactment of the ‘Virtual Asset User Protection Act’ was also cited as a noteworthy virtual asset policy to look forward to.

However, Block B also pointed out, “Even under the previous Yoon Suk-yeol administration, efforts were made to promote virtual assets, but many things were delayed during the three-year term.”

Meanwhile, during the election campaign, President Lee presented several virtual asset pledges: ▲Introduction of a Korean won-pegged stablecoin, ▲Legalization of investments in spot virtual asset ETFs, ▲Consideration of allowing ICOs and STOs, ▲Deferral of virtual asset taxation, ▲Strengthening investor protection, ▲Supporting the virtual asset ecosystem, ▲Strict punishment of illegal activities, ▲Easing of exchange regulations.
